Roy Noble acoustic Guitars In Stock


 For 14 years as the dealer for Roy Noble, we have enjoyed a steady supply of these professional studio grade guitars. Mr Noble has a long history of building the highest quality guitars used in numerous recordings spanning over forty years. Mr Noble works alone, and creates approximately 20 fine guitars per year.        * Myth dispelled: Do you realize that there are ALMOST NO RECORDINGS of Clarence White playing the "large soundhole D-28" in the studio? There are some shots of him playing it on the Andy Griffith Show...
Yet there are extensive recordings of Clarence White playing Roy Noble Guitars, "live" and in studio, and almost all film footage has him playing his Noble.

Roy Noble Coco Bolo Concert Custom 1 Buy Roy Noble Coco Bolo Concert Custom 1 2002 Roy Noble Coco Bolo Concert Custom Guitar 'On Hold'

     Exc.(+) Condition. Frets have the slightest sign of playing in the first position. Otherwise, this guitar is absolutely clean.
     Creamy Adirondack Spruce top packed with silky medullary side rays. Beautiful quarter-sawn Coco Bolo back and sides with highly figured Maple back wedge. Top and soundhole rossette have Roy Noble's hand-made wooden purfling. multiple wooden bindings on the back. Ivoroid binding on fretboard and peghead. Mahogany neck with radiused Gabon Ebony fretboard and pearl "cut-diamond" inlays. Nickel Waverly tuners with Ivoroid buttons. Coco Bolo peghead venner. Bone saddle, Ivory nut and pins.
     The tone on Roy Noble guitars is unbeatable. Every note played on this guitar is strong and clean. The sound fills the room even with the smaller body shape and light gauge strings that we use on Noble's. This guitar looks new, but has the mature sound of a guitar that's been around for a number of years.

Roy Noble HD-100 1 Buy Roy Noble HD-100 1 2009 Roy Noble HD-100 Guitar 'In Stock'

     Exceptional Condition. There is almost no evidence of player wear on the guitar. The top, back and sides are all very clean with no marks. The back of the neck is in great shape and there is just minimal signs of fret wear. Has never had an enpin or strap button installed.
     Adirondack Spruce top. Straight-grain quarter-sawn Brazilian Rosewood back and sides. Top and back of body have multiple wood bindings, with flamed Maple outer binding. Herringbone purflings around edge of top and around soundhole rosette. Neck and peghead are single bound with Ivoroid. Decorative wooden strip in center seam on back. Mahogany neck, radiused Ebony fingerboard with Pearl "Cut Diamond" inlays. Nickel Waverly tuners with Ivoroid buttons. Ivory saddle with original bone saddle in case. There is also an Ivory nut blank in the case with the original bone nut on the guitar.
     Very strong, balanced tone. Great presence on every string, and when chords are played each individual note rings out in the mix.

Roy Noble HD-100 Brazilian 1 Buy Roy Noble HD-100 Brazilian 1 2004 Roy Noble HD-100 Brazilian Master Grade Woods Guitar 'On Hold'

     Exc.(++) Condition. This guitar is really clean with very slight signs of previous ownership. There are light scratches in the pickguard and one hard to find nick on the top. Back, sides and neck are all very clean with no marks and no fret wear.
     High-grade Adirondack Spruce top with beautiful grain, side rays and bearclaw figure. Beautiful Brazilian Rosewood back and sides. This is a rare piece of Rosewood from the lower section of the bole. It is quarter-sawn with strikingly beautiful maiden-hair ribbon figure. The top and back have multiple wooden bindings with flamed Maple showing on the outside. Herringbone purfling on the top and around soundhole rossette. Nut, saddle and pins are all Ivory. Fretboard and peghead are bound with Ivoroid. Mahogany neck. Radiused Gabon Ebony fingerboard with pearl "cut-diamond" inlays. Nickel Waverly tuners with Ivoroid buttons.
     Exceptionally fine sound. Wide open with great balance, depth and clarity of notes.
